Simple Setup, Real Winning Angles
This is a 3-reel slot with 5 paylines, so you’re not juggling a maze of lines or confusing reels. You’re aiming for crisp, readable wins that show up fast and keep the bankroll moving.
The symbol set leans into tropical fruit and playful animals: Banana, Coconut, Dragon Fruit, Guava, Mango, Pineapple, Starfruit, Watermelon, plus the Monkey. The real attention-grabbers are the coin symbols—Banana Coin and Monkey Coin—which tie directly into the feature action and can turn an ordinary spin into a momentum shift.
Betting stays straightforward: 1 coin per line, coin sizes ranging from $0.01 up to $3, and a max bet of $15. That makes it friendly for low-stake grinders, while still giving bigger-stake players enough room to push for stronger payouts per hit.
